Have a pre-sale home inspection. Be proactive by arranging for a pre-sale home inspec-
tion. An inspector will be able to give you a good indication of the trouble areas that will
stand out to potential buyers, and you’ll be able to make repairs before open houses
begin.
Organize and clean. Pare down clutter and pack up your least-used items, such as large
blenders and other kitchen tools, out-of-season clothes, toys, and exercise equipment.
Store items off-site or in boxes neatly arranged in the garage or basement. Clean the win-
dows, carpets, walls, lighting fixtures, and baseboards to make the house shine.
Get replacement estimates. Do you have big-ticket items that are worn our or will need to
be replaced soon, such your roof or carpeting? Get estimates on how much it would cost
to replace them, even if you don’t plan to do it yourself. The figures will help buyers deter-
mine if they can afford the home, and will be handy when negotiations begin.
Find your warranties. Gather up the warranties, guarantees, and user manuals for the fur-
nace, washer and dryer, dishwasher, and any other items that will remain with the house.
Spruce up the curb appeal. Pretend you’re a buyer and stand outside of your home. As
you approach the front door, what is your impression of the property? Do the lawn and
bushes look neatly manicured? Is the address clearly visible? Are pretty flowers or plants
framing the entrance? Is the walkway free from cracks and impediments?

What is Appraised Value?
Appraisals provide an objective opinion of value, but it’s not an exact science so appraisals may differ.
For buying and selling purposes, appraisals are usually based on market value — what the property could
probably be sold for. Other types of value include insurance value, replacement value, and assessed value
for property tax purposes.
Appraised value is not a constant number. Changes in market conditions can dramatically alter appraised
value.
Appraised value doesn’t take into account special considerations, like the need to sell rapidly.
Lenders usually use either the appraised value or the sale price, whichever is less, to determine the amount
of the mortgage they will offer.

Here’s a fun look at possible price tags for presidential properties.
Yowza! A recent appraisal of The White House — as a prime property, not the seat of world power — set its
price at $1.5 billion (with a B).
The Wall Street Journal turned to D.C. appraiser Dennis Duffy to put a price tag on three current and former
presidential properties: The White House; Mount Vernon, George Washington’s home; and Monticello, Thomas
Jefferson’s home. Duffy considered the cost to rebuild, value of outbuildings, infrastructure, and land that could
be sold.
Duffy’s appraisal results:
White House: 100,000 sq. ft., 13 bedrooms, 35 bathrooms, and 18 acres of prime downtown real estate — $1.5 billion
Mount Vernon: 7,000 sq. ft. in suburban D.C., river view of the Potomac (though no bathrooms) — $150 million
Monticello: 11,000 sq. ft., four stories, 43 rooms, exquisite artisanship — $106.5 million

Why Home Equity Beats Facebook Equity
By: Dona DeZube
Facebook’s IPO and subsequent stock value points up a simple truth: It’s easy to get caught up in the notion of getting rich quick. But there’s no surer way to wealth than home ownership.
As Facebook’s IPO approached, it was easy to start traveling down the “what if” path: “What if I had equity in Facebook?!? How rich would I be?” If my parents had only bought me Berkshire Hathaway stock for my first birthday in 1962, I’d have made some serious money in stock equities.
Alas, they didn’t recognize the hot stock of their era any more than I would recognize the hot stock of mine. Like most Americans, it’s home equity, not stock equity, that will pad my bank account when I hit the retire-ment finish line. About two-thirds of Americans invest in home ownership, but only half of us invest in stocks. (I suspect this is in no small part because we have to make our mortgage payments every month or the bank comes and takes our houses back.) The fact is, more of us are getting rich by buying and paying off our homes than by picking the next Facebook. Here are some interesting facts from the National Center for Real Estate Research:
6 in 10 of us have more home equity than stock equity.
One-fifth of Americans’ total net worth is home equity.
Home owners accumulate, on average, $167,000 in their lifetimes, compared to $42,000 for renters.
The median wealth for the poorest American home owners, those earning less than $20,000, is 81 times that of renters with similar income.
In a recent study that took into account falling home prices, buying was still more likely to generate wealth than renting, simply because renters are more inclined to spend instead of save and invest in stocks.
The bottom line is this: Even if renting appears cheaper on a spreadsheet, the forced savings of home owner-ship leads to wealth more reliably than renting. Many of us simply don’t have the willpower or motivation to save our discretionary income and invest it in stocks. So unless you’ve got the inside track on the next hot future IPO, keep making your mortgage payments.
